aaah right. basically you have to pay for the training which is uber expensive and then get hours.
its dificult to get hours because no one trusts you. many people will work as an egineer for a company and log hours when they can. also i think he got most his hours working in nigeria on oil rigds. now he has enough to be trusted captain and flies all sorts of things. recreational/touristy, medi vacs, engineering/transport etc etc.he is living the dream out there. but he is a very lucky one, out of all the people he did the course with, he is one of the only dudes to have a steady,good job

State employees began an aerial wolf hunt on the Yukon border on Tuesday in what officials describe as an effort to preserve caribou for shooting by hunters. Officials at the adjacent Yukon-Charlie Rivers National Preserve argued against the hunt, saying that the wolves have had a particularly hard winter and need to recover. The state plans to kill as much as 80 percent of the local wolf population in the next week, or 185 wolves; there are an estimated 46,500 caribou. Since 2006 the state has regularly granted hunting licenses or assumed the task itself in planes or helicopters.
